Output d5993adba9534a4690243f69dfa6f63da355b003e305850dbcfe2d4d5490faf3:183

value
906590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7afa396689f3ccc00425bd3d42d18c3e6352d4a6 OP_EQUAL
address
3CuG7q8pGbLcrAU9awRa7vANQfKHQX3cSA
transaction
d5993adba9534a4690243f69dfa6f63da355b003e305850dbcfe2d4d5490faf3
spent
true